Situated in permit PMP 323 acreage offshore Malaysia, the Belumut area consists of four fields, East Belumut, West Belumut, Lerek and Chermingat in the Malay Basin. Spanning 335,000 acres about 185 miles (298 kilometers) offshore Kemaman, Terengganu, the four fields hold an estimated 360 million barrels of oil in place. Serving as operator of the permit is Newfield, owning a 60% interest; Carigali owns 40%.

East Belumut

During exploratory campaigns in the late 1970s and 1990s, Exxon discovered East Belumut, but the field wasn't developed. In 2005, Newfield Exploration signed a Production Sharing Contract on PM323 in mid-2005 and began developing the small marginal field.

Once the contract was signed, the operator moved forward with development through two phases. In the first phase, the company brought one oil producer and one gas injector online and connected them to a Central Processing Platform, East Belumut A. Phase two consisted of increasing production capacity by drilling five additional wells, and boosting gas injection capability for reservoir maintenance. Around 2010, the operator plans to drill 15 additional producers in the field.

The East Belumut A is a drilling/process/accommodations platform with a production capacity of 50,000 bopd. The platform is a four-pile design with a skirt pile support jacket structure that supports an integrated deck with processing, compression and utility capabilities.

Estimated to hold 20 to 25 MMbbl, East Belumut commenced production on June 30, 2008.

Chermingat

In waters measuring 213 feet (65 meters), Chermingat's development consisted of drilling one extended reach well and two directional wells, and connecting them to a wellhead platform, Chermingat A (CHR-A), which is tied-back to the East Belumut A platform for processing and export.

The CHR-A platform is an unmanned, remote, minimal facility that is a three-legged steel-insert-piled tripod structure with four well slots. Estimated to hold 7 MMbbl, the field came online on May 18, 2008.

West Belumut

Field development of West Belumut will consist of drilling two development wells and connecting them to a wellhead platform tied-back to East Belumut A platform.

Holding an estimated 4 MMbbl, West Belumut is expected to come online in 2011 or 2012.

Lerek

Situated 31 miles (50 kilometers) from East Belumut, Lerek's plan for development calls for seven to 12 development wells connecting to the Lerek CPP and tied-back to East Belumut A platform. Lerek will commence production sometime in 2011 or 2012.

Newfield Increases Production in Belumut/Chermingat Complex
Type: Status Update

Jul. 2012 - Newfield Exploration reported that the East Belumut/Chermingat complex achieved a recent production record of more than 43,000 bopd. The increase in production is a result of recent successful development drilling and facility optimization.

East Belumut Flows Again Following Repairs to Damaged Pipeline
Type: Status Update

Aug. 2010 - Oil production from the East Belumut field has resumed following repairs to a damaged oil pipeline connecting the East Belumut platform to the Tinggi platform. Production from the field has returned to a rate of more than 20,000 bopd. The field is located in license PM 323, about 160 miles (257 kilometers) offshore Peninsular Malaysia in 240 feet (73 meters) of water.

Newfield Shuts East Belumut Production, Repairs Pipeline Damage
Type: Subsea Equipment

Jul. 2010 - An unidentified marine vessel has damaged an oil pipeline connecting the East Belumut platform to the Tinggi platform. Newfield Exploration, operator, has shut-in production from the oil field and the leak was isolated. The East Belumut field was producing about 20 Mbopd prior to shut-in. It should take approximately six to eight weeks to complete and return East Belumut to production. The field is located in license PM 323, about 160 miles (257 kilometers) offshore Peninsular Malaysia in 240 feet (73 meters) of water.

Second Phase Development of East Belumut Starts Soon
Type: Status Update

Sep. 2009 - Newfield is accelerating East Belumut's second phase of development by leasing a jackup to start the field's six-well drilling campaign. Drilling plans call for three development wells to be drilled during the fourth quarter of 2009 and three wells to be drilled in the first quarter of 2010. The second phase of development is aimed at increasing the field's production capacity by drilling additional wells and boosting gas injection capability.
